Classic and Timeless Designs
Often called "Old School", this style is characterized by strong, clean lines and a simple color palette, typically featuring vibrant, basic hues. You'll often see roses, anchors, eagles, and skulls. Expressive Watercolour Styles
A newer trend, watercolor tattoos emulate the look of a painting. They are known for soft color blending, splatters, and a the omission of solid black outlines.
